istata输入“ outreg2 using 2013~2023修改后数据doc. replace sum(log) title (Decriptive stati > stics)”后出现invalid 'replace' 怎么整
时间: 2024-12-17 07:56:16 浏览: 11
原创】stata介绍之outreg2logout从简单到基础涵盖描述相关回归从时间到面板.docx
在 stata 中,当你尝试使用 `outreg2` 命令时遇到 "invalid 'replace'" 错误,这通常意味着你试图在一个不允许替换数据的操作中使用 `replace` 子句。在 `outreg2` 命令中,`replace` 选项用于覆盖原始的数据文件,但如果原始文件不存在或者你没有指定正确的文件路径,就会报错。
解决这个问题需要检查以下几点:
1. 确保你的命令语法正确:`outreg2` 命令应该看起来像这样:
```stata
outreg2 using "2013~2023修改后数据.doc", title("Descriptive Statistics") replace
```
检查文件名和路径是否完整且正确,注意引号的使用,以及日期范围和文件扩展名是否准确。
2. 如果你想覆盖原有的文档,确保你有权限并且真的想要这样做。如果不想覆盖原有文件,可以省略 `replace` 或者加上 `if 0` 来创建一个新的文件。
3. 确认文件存在:在运行命令之前,可以在 stata 的交互模式下使用 `use` 或 `list` 命令确认文件 `2013~2023修改后数据.doc` 是否已经存在于当前工作目录或者你指定的路径中。
4. 检查 stata 是否已连接到正确的工作目录:如果文件不在当前目录,你需要先使用 `cd` 或 `use` 命令切换到包含该文件的目录。
如果你按照上述步骤检查并仍然收到错误,可能是 stata 自身的问题或者文件格式不对,建议查阅 stata 文档或联系 stata 支持团队获取进一步帮助。
阅读全文